Memorandum of Oral Decision Delivered by A. Cornacchia on October 14, 2021 and Order of the Tribunal
Background
1The Tribunal held a second Case Management Conference ("CMC") concerning the Applicant's development proposal for the lands known municipally as 49 and 57 Folkard Lane in the County ("Subject Property").
2The Applicant has appealed the County's failure to deal with its rezoning application and site plan application for the Subject Property within the prescribed statutory time periods.
3The parties updated the Tribunal on the status of their settlement discussions and the preparation of their draft Procedural Order. The parties have focused their efforts on settling this case and have not spent any time on the preparation of a revised draft Procedural Order. The parties requested the Tribunal to set a deadline of January 14, 2022 for either the conclusion of a settlement agreement and a request to set up a settlement hearing or submission of draft Procedural Order with a comprehensive issues list and the request for a merits hearing. The parties do not believe that there is a need to set up an additional CMC at this time but wish the option to contact the Case Coordinator to request a CMC, if either party decides that it is necessary.
Order
4The Tribunal orders that:
If the parties settle this case on or before January 14, 2022 at 4:30 p.m., the parties shall jointly submit a comprehensive written status update to the Case Coordinator by January 14, 2022 at 4:30 p.m. advising whether the Settlement Agreement has been approved by the County Council, including a copy of the approved Settlement Agreement, and a request for a settlement hearing with the required number of hearing days.
If this case is not settled on or before January 14, 2022 at 4:30 p.m., the parties shall jointly submit a written status update to the Case Coordinator by January 14, 2022 at 4:30 p.m. along with a revised draft Procedural Order, Issues List, and a draft hearing plan for approval by the Tribunal and a request for a hearing with the required number of hearing days.
The draft Procedural Order will include the mandatory meetings of all like experts and the preparation of an agreed Statement of Facts.
The draft Issues List shall include a comprehensive list of issues relevant to the Appeal organized beneath a statement of each applicable statutory provision of the Planning Act to be considered by the Tribunal.
